CHAPTER 1361. DETECTION AND PREVENTION OF OSTEOPOROSIS


Sec. 1361.001. DEFINITION. In this chapter, "qualified enrollee" means an individual entitled to coverage under a group health benefit plan who is:

(1) a postmenopausal woman who is not receiving estrogen replacement therapy;

(2) an individual with:

(A) vertebral abnormalities;

(B) primary hyperparathyroidism; or

(C) a history of bone fractures; or

(3) an individual who is:

(A) receiving long-term glucocorticoid therapy; or

(B) being monitored to assess the response to or efficacy of an approved osteoporosis drug therapy.

Sec. 1361.002. APPLICABILITY OF CHAPTER. This chapter applies only to a group health benefit plan delivered, issued for delivery, or renewed in this state that provides coverage for medical or surgical expenses incurred as a result of accident or sickness, including:

(1) a group insurance policy;

(2) a group contract issued by a group hospital service corporation operating under Chapter 842; and

(3) a group contract issued by a health maintenance organization operating under Chapter 843.

Sec. 1361.003. COVERAGE REQUIRED. A group health benefit plan must provide to a qualified enrollee coverage for medically accepted bone mass measurement to detect low bone mass and to determine the enrollee's risk of osteoporosis and fractures associated with osteoporosis.
